Sam Hafertepe Jr. Not Sweating ASCS Winless Streak, Focused on Another Belleville Sweep
Sam Hafertepe Jr. is back in familiar territory this season, rising to the top of multiple categories with the American Sprint Car Series. But one key stat is still missing after 11 races for the current Series points leader – a win. This is the longest the Sunnyvale, TX native has gone into a full season with ASCS without a win since his first full year on tour

Head-to-head once again, the ASCS Western Plains Region will take on the ASCS Northern Plains Region in the state of Wyoming this weekend, with two nights at Sweetwater Speedway in Rock Springs. Adam Trimble was king of the weekend in 2025, with a sweep of action at the three-eights-mile oval.

Matt Covington has seen this script before. Sam Hafertepe Jr. leads the American Sprint Car Series points, while Covington remains on his tail for the title fight entering the summer stretch. Adding his name to the list of winners with another ASCS Region, Oklahoma’s Matt Covington bested the ASCS Hurricane Area Super Sprints Saturday night at Ark-La-Tex Speedway in Vivian, La.
